반응형
문제
https://www.acmicpc.net/problem/1264
영문 문장을 입력받아 모음의 개수를 세는 프로그램을 작성하시오. 모음은 'a', 'e', 'i', 'o', 'u'이며 대문자 또는 소문자이다.
입력
입력은 여러 개의 테스트 케이스로 이루어져 있으며, 각 줄마다 영어 대소문자, ',', '.', '!', '?', 공백으로 이루어진 문장이 주어진다. 각 줄은 최대 255글자로 이루어져 있다.
입력의 끝에는 한 줄에 '#' 한 글자만이 주어진다.
출력
각 줄마다 모음의 개수를 세서 출력한다.
코드
while True:
cnt=0
n=input()
if n == "#":
break
for i in n:
if i in "aeiouAEIOU":
cnt+=1
print(cnt)
문제 해결
문자열 기초 문제이다.
반응형
'Problem Solving > 백준' 카테고리의 다른 글
[백준] 1330번: 두 수 비교하기 - [Python/파이썬] (0) | 2023.04.12 |
---|---|
[백준] - 1271번 : 엄청난 부자2 - [Python/파이썬] (0) | 2023.04.12 |
[백준] 1260번: DFS와 BFS - [Python/파이썬] (0) | 2023.04.12 |
[백준] 1245번: 농장관리 - [Python/파이썬] (0) | 2023.04.12 |
[백준] 1235번: 학생번호 - [Python/파이썬] (0) | 2023.04.12 |